The flow profiles shown in Figs. 12 and 13, show the development of the bulk liquid velocity profile from the central entrance region to the outer extremity of the inter-disk gap where the liquid exits. The development of a reverse flow in the lower part of the gap as the radial coordinate increases is consistent with other simulations in spinning disk reactors [20]. Fig. 15 shows the development of the velocity profile in the case of the grooved disk, showing that the same reverse flow is observed within the groove spaces in addition to the main inter-disk spaces
